Which parent gets to stay in bed while the other tends to the kiddiwinks is a much sleepily debated topic, sorted out amongst couples in a wide variety of ways. It involves bribes, pleas, and promises that we’ll do it ‘next time’.

 

But now a new study has answered the prayers of women everywhere – we now have solid scientific proof that MUM should be the one to sleep in. And who can argue with science? Ahm, no one.

 

Yep, a study published in the Journal of Clinical Endocrinology and Metabolism on the effect of sleep on diabetes showed that when women sleep in it may help protect them against diabetes, but if men sleep in it might increase their risk of diabetes.

 

 

You know, so when we’re asking (read: nudging forcibly) our partners to get up while we snoozey snooze, we’re really only doing it because we care deeply about their health and welfare…
